GPD Finds Explosive Devices in Vehicle at Race trac; Prompts Visit From ATF and Other Agencies

September 18, 2021

On 09-17-2021, officers with the Granbury Police Department encountered a vehicle which was reported to have been stolen. The two occupants were detained in the parking lot at Race Trac on South Morgan Street, and the vehicle was subsequently searched. Officers found three improvised explosive devices in the car during the search. Members of the Fort Worth Police Department Bomb Squad, Fort Worth Fire Department Bomb Squad, and Bureau of Alcohol, Tobacco, Firearms and Explosives agents responded to assist. After the initial investigation, a Glen Rose woman who was a passenger was released with no charges. 41 year old Lancer Holloway of Houston was ultimately arrested for three counts of Possession of Prohibited Weapon for the explosive devices, and Unauthorized Use of a Vehicle.

Lieutenant Russell Grizzard
Granbury Police Department
